Benjamin Harrison YMCA
The Benjamin Harrison YMCA Pickleball Court in Indianapolis, Indiana offers an excellent opportunity to play the fast-growing sport of pickleball. The facility has three indoor courts, offering a comfortable and competitive environment for players of all skill levels. Each court is equipped with permanent, portable wood netting, as well as restrooms and wheelchair accessibility for those that need it. Water is also available on the premises, making it easy for players to take a quick break between matches.
